BC/BE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ation physician
Trinity Health of New England
We put you FIRST because you put patients first.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ation opportunity in Chicopee, Massachusetts. Trinity Health Of New England Medical Group is seeking a full-time BC/BE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ation physician to join our growing Physiatry team in Chicopee, Massachusetts. Join an expanding practice with a team of two physicians and two PAs who are providing non-operative management of spine pain and comprehensive physiatry services within Trinity Health Of New England’s extensive primary and multispecialty care network. Our team provides full-spectrum physical medicine and rehabilitation services, interventional procedures and an expanded MSK and neuro rehabilitation practice. Enjoy a 100% outpatient 4.5-day, Monday-Friday workweek with no call requirements within a group that offers excellent support and resources and the ability to build a successful practice dedicated to compassionate patient care. The successful candidate should be BC/BE in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ation with a Fellowship in Pain or Spine Injections or interest in injections and procedures, specifically vertebroplasties and ablations. Practicing in Chicopee, located within the greater Springfield, Massachusetts metro area, puts you in the heart of New England. This small city environment of 700,000 residents offers a tremendous selection of welcoming neighborhoods in which to live, excellent public and private schools and colleges, great restaurants, shopping, music, museums and historical areas. The central New England location puts you within a commutable distance from Hartford, Connecticut and in close proximity to New York City and Boston with easy access to dependable air and rail services.
